Ukrainian budget receives UAH 5.6 bln in war tax over eight months

Ukrainian taxpayers paid UAH 5.6 billion in war tax to the state budget in January-August 2015, up by 15.1% of the targeted value, according to the State Fiscal Service (SFS).

The SFS reports that the amount of tax paid in August totaled UAH 743.6 million, which is 15.8% higher than the targeted value.

As UNIAN reported earlier, a temporary war tax of 1.5% on the wage fund was introduced in August 2014 as an additional source of funding for the Ukrainian army, engaged in the Anti-Terrorist Operation in conflict-torn Donbas.
